macromutation in American English
noun: a mutation that has a profound effect on the resulting organism, as a change in a regulatory gene that controls the expression of many structural genes macromutation in British English noun: an abnormally great change in the characteristics of a population of animals or plants over relatively few successive generations: hypothesized in the evolutionary theory of punctuated equilibrium, which states that such populations remain stable for long |
